Transaction dd640856137da35c7dbf991674403858671ca13933445dcdc8e9cc4957177097
1 Input
1 Output
-
dd640856137da35c7dbf991674403858671ca13933445dcdc8e9cc4957177097:0
- value
- 1639148035
- script pubkey
- OP_PUSHBYTES_33 034377208ba87e7b62126135c5318dee95e591f1c7703540d0b982e1748c0d4497 OP_CHECKSIG